Dein Alltag dreht sich um die Entwicklung und Optimierung von Embedded-Software für Mikrocontroller. Dabei analysierst du Anforderungen, entwirfst Softwarearchitekturen und führst Tests durch, während du eng mit anderen Bereichen zusammenarbeitest.
Anforderungen
- •Abgeschlossenes Studium in Informatik
- •Mindestens 5 Jahre Berufserfahrung
- •Fundierte Kenntnisse in C und C++
- •Praktische Erfahrung mit STM32 Ecosystem
- •Vertiefte Erfahrung mit RTOS
- •Erfahrung mit Debugging-Tools
- •Erfahrung mit SIL-/HIL-Tests
- •Fundierte Erfahrung mit Continuous Integration
- •Analytisches Denken und strukturierte Arbeitsweise
- •Sehr gute Deutsch- und Englischkenntnisse
Deine Aufgaben
- •Embedded Software für STM32-Mikrocontroller entwickeln
- •Softwarearchitekturen für Echtzeitsysteme entwerfen
- •Systemanforderungen analysieren und technische Spezifikationen definieren
- •Code-Reviews, Unit-Tests und Integrationstests durchführen
- •Eng mit Hardware-Entwicklung und QA zusammenarbeiten
- •Gesamten Entwicklungszyklus betreuen
- •Bei Inbetriebnahme und Performance-Optimierung unterstützen
Deine Vorteile
Flexible Arbeitszeiten
Home Office Möglichkeit
40-Stunden Woche
Mindestens 5 Wochen Ferien
Innovation und Forschung am Hauptsitz
Kontinuierliche Investitionen in Forschung
Kostenlose Kaffeegetränke
Original Beschreibung
## Über Franke
Wir suchen dich, einen erfahrenen Softwareentwickler, der sein Know-how einbringt und unsere Plattform mit Herz, Hirn und Code weiterentwickelt. Du übernimmst Verantwortung in einem interdisziplinären SCRUM-Team, arbeitest eng mit Kollegen aus unterschiedlichen Fachbereichen zusammen und bringst dich sowohl konzeptionell als auch praktisch in die Weiterentwicklung unserer Produkte ein. Du verstehst es, komplexe Anforderungen in nachhaltige Softwarearchitektur zu übersetzen und hast Freude daran, gemeinsam im Team moderne Lösungen zu entwickeln.
## Deine Aufgaben
* Entwicklung, Implementierung und Optimierung von Embedded Software für Mikrocontroller der STM32-Familie
* Entwurf und Pflege von Softwarearchitekturen für verteilte Echtzeitsysteme
* Analyse von Systemanforderungen und Definition technischer Spezifikationen
* Durchführung von Code-Reviews, Unit-Tests sowie Integrationstests
* Enge Zusammenarbeit mit Hardware-Entwicklung, Systemarchitektur und QA
* Betreuung des gesamten Entwicklungszyklus – von der Konzeption bis zur Serienreife
* Unterstützung bei Inbetriebnahme, Fehlersuche und Performance-Optimierung auf Zielhardware
## Dein Profil
* Abgeschlossenes Studium in Informatik, Elektrotechnik oder vergleichbare Qualifikation
* Mindestens 5 Jahre Berufserfahrung in der Embedded-Software-Entwicklung
* Fundierte Kenntnisse in C und C++ für Embedded-Systeme
* Praktische Erfahrung mit dem STM32 Ecosystem
* Vertiefte Erfahrung mit RTOS, vorzugsweise FreeRTOS
* Erfahrung im Umgang mit gängigen Debugging- und Trace-Tools
* Erfahrung mit SIL-/HIL-Tests zur Validierung eingebetteter Systeme
* Fundierte Erfahrung mit Continuous Integration (CI) und agilen Entwicklungsmethoden
* Analytisches Denken, strukturierte Arbeitsweise und Teamfähigkeit
* Sehr gute Deutsch- und Englischkenntnisse in Wort und Schrift
## Was wir bieten
* Flexible Arbeitszeiten & agile Kultur
* Home Office Möglichkeit
* 40-Stunden Woche
* Mindestens 5 Wochen Ferien
* Innovation, Forschung & Entwicklung sowie Produktion am Hauptsitz
* Kontinuierliche Investitionen in Forschung & Entwicklung
* Kostenlose Kaffeegetränke vom Espresso bis zum Latte Macchiato
## Eine Welt voller Möglichkeiten – für unsere Mitarbeitenden und vielleicht auch für dich?
**Wichtige Information für alle Executive Search Unternehmen, Headhunter und Personalberater**
Die Franke Gruppe akzeptiert keine unaufgeforderte Unterstützung von Headhuntern und Personalberatern für unsere Karriere-Opportunitäten. Alle CVs/Lebensläufe, die von externen Personaldienstleistern an Franke oder ihre Mitarbeiter übermittelt werden, ohne dass eine gültige schriftliche Vereinbarung für eine Personalsuche mit bezahlten Bezug auf die betreffende Stelle besteht, gelten als alleiniges Eigentum unseres Unternehmens. Für den Fall, dass von einer Agentur vorgestellte Kandidaten in unserer Firma eingestellt werden und keine vorgängige Vereinbarung besteht, werden keine Gebühren bezahlt.